Water-Wise Irrigation Practices for a Thirsty World

As international water consumption increases and shifting weather patterns exacerbate droughts , embracing sustainable irrigation techniques becomes vital. Traditional flood application is notoriously inefficient , leading to significant water loss . Moving towards precision irrigation, which encompasses techniques like drip systems , micro-sprinklers, and soil moisture monitoring devices, can dramatically minimize water usage and improve harvest production while protecting precious water resources . Furthermore, thought should be given to recycled water for irrigation to alleviate pressure on clean water sources .

The History and Evolution of Irrigation Systems

From primitive times, humans have sought ways to control water for agriculture . The methods were incredibly basic , involving directing water from proximate waterways directly onto fields . Around 2800 B.C.E. , civilizations in Mesopotamia developed more advanced systems, including canals and hand-operated pumps to transport water. During the ages, irrigation progressed , with the Romans constructing vast systems and Islamic cultures pioneering methods like the qanat, a subterranean channel system. Today's irrigation encompasses a diverse range of methods, such as drip irrigation and pivot sprinkler , greatly increasing crop production and performance while attempting to conserve precious water reserves.
